
French pet food manufacturer Saga Nutrition has partnered with packaging supplier Mondi to introduce recyclable mono-material bags for its dry pet food products, replacing traditional multi-material plastic packaging.
Launched in October 2024, the new packaging is part of Mondi’s re/cycle portfolio and was developed to meet internal circularity benchmarks as well as CEFLEX recycling guidelines. Known as the re/cycle FlexiBag, the solution offers high-barrier protection against moisture, fat, and odor, and is available in sizes starting at 3 kilograms.

Saga Nutrition, which employs 30 people and produces a full range of dry dog and cat food, will mark its 25th anniversary in 2025.
